Ahmad Zahid: Power to detain lies with five-member panel


Taking safety measures: Dr Ahmad Zahid looking through the draft of the proposed Prevention Of Terrorism Bill which is to be tabled in Parliament this month.

PUTRAJAYA: The proposed Prevention of Terrorism Act (Pota) is not a copy of the abolished Internal Security Act (ISA) and is necessary for the country to better contain local and foreign terrorists.

“It is purely a preventive law to deal with domestic terrorist threats and foreign terrorists coming into the country,” said Home Minister Datuk Seri Dr Ahmad Zahid Hamidi in an exclusive interview yesterday.
